INSPECT WIRING HARNESS BETWEEN ABS HU/CM AND INSTRUMENT CLUSTER
• Disconnect the ABS HU/CM connector.
• Inspect the wiring harnesses between following terminals for the short to ground, short to power supply and open circuit:
-
- ABS HU/CM terminal D and instrument cluster terminal 2W*1
-
- ABS HU/CM terminal P and instrument cluster terminal 2X*1
-
- ABS HU/CM terminal L and instrument cluster terminal 2W*2
-
- ABS HU/CM terminal H and instrument cluster terminal 2X*2
*1: Australian specs (applied VIN (assumed): JM0 DY10Y100 100001-108401), General R.H.D. specs (without WU-TWC)
*2: Australian specs (applied VIN (assumed): JM0 DY10Y100 108402-, General R.H.D. specs (with WU-TWC)
• Is the wiring harness normal?
|
Yes
|
Replace the instrument cluster, then go to Step 10.
|
No
|
Replace the wiring harness.

INSPECT WIRING HARNESS BETWEEN PCM AND ABS HU/CM
• Disconnect the negative battery cable.
• Disconnect the ABS HU/CM connector.
• Inspect the wiring harnesses between following terminals for the short to ground, short to power supply and open circuit:
-
- PCM terminal 1S and ABS HU/CM terminal D*1
-
- PCM terminal 1W and ABS HU/CM terminal P*1
-
- PCM terminal 1S and ABS HU/CM terminal L*2
-
- PCM terminal 1W and ABS HU/CM terminal H*2
*1: Australian specs (applied VIN (assumed): JM0 DY10Y100 100001-108401), General R.H.D. specs (without WU-TWC)
*2: Australian specs (applied VIN (assumed): JM0 DY10Y100 108402-, General R.H.D. specs (with WU-TWC)
• Is the wiring harness normal?
|
Yes
|
Replace the PCM, then go to the next step.
|
No
|
Replace the wiring harness.
